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of captivate

- To take prisoner; to capture; to subdue.
- To acquire ascendancy over by reason of some art or attraction; to fascinate; to charm; as, Cleopatra captivated Antony; the orator captivated all hearts.
- Taken prisoner; made captive; insnared; charmed.

Crossword clue for captivate

- Bewitch
- Enslave
- Hold spellbound